How do I turn off Welcome Screen and Tips in Windows 10?

In particular, after installing the big update that comes regularly every six months, Windows 10 displays a special welcome page, which is partly about the most important features and partly about unsolicited tips for using the operating system. To prevent this unwanted help, open the Start menu by right-clicking on the Start button and left-clicking on the Start menu entry. Select the System category and go to Notifications and Actions in the left column.

In the main window, under Notifications, turn off the Show Windows Welcome screen, which is on by default after updates and occasionally at normal logon, to see what’s new and suggestions and the Show tips, tricks, and suggestions when using Windows settings.

In addition, you can safely turn off Device Setup Tips, which also rarely contain really useful settings.
